The Navarro Health System may attend up to 120 people in the ICU | Radio Pamplona

The Minister of Health, Santos Induráin, explained this Monday that throughout the week will start receiving medical supplies to cope with the coronavirus crisis. Specifically, they will be received in stages 114,800 masks, in addition to gloves and glasses, which will be distributed among the health centers. Some measures that have been required for days after the increase in infections among health personnel. For the moment, up to 161 professionals from the Navarre Health System have tested positive for coronavirus, among restrooms, socio-restrooms (where the staff of nursing homes is included), Administration, caretakers, maintenance, etc.

Induráin stresses that rapid tests will be used by applying prioritization criteria. In other words, health professionals and essential professions, such as firefighters or police, among others, will have preference.

On the other hand, the regional government rules out using the beds of the hotels of the Community to attend to patients because “at the moment it is not a necessity and it is not being considered.” In fact, Santos is forceful when stating that “at the moment there is no collapse situation. ” The Government is evaluating the option of enabling some hotels and establishments so that the toilets that require them may reside in them and reduce the spread of the virus.

“We have capacity for 120 places in the ICU”

The coordinator of the Contingency Plan, Alfredo Martínez, explained that “it is true that with the traditional ICU places we could not cope to the epidemic because we will continue to have patients in need of an ICU due to traffic accidents, etc. What we are doing is more than doubling the capacity of critical posts in Navarra. We are enabling the rooms available for monitoring with both equipment and professionals to significantly increase the number of units in the Community. In these moments we would be able to reach 120 seats and we are working to continue increasing them, depending on the needs that are detected “.

That is, all the respirators that are available in the Foral Community will be placed in those rooms that can be enabled to attend critically ill patients, such as the operating rooms of the operating rooms, the CMA rooms, endoscopy rooms, etc.

Suspension of flights

The director general of Transport, Berta Miranda, has appeared today to announce that since all flights are suspended today from Noáin airport. Of course, the airline Air Nostrum plans to resume service from March 29.

On the other hand, Miranda has explained that the transport of passengers and goods has fallen in Navarra between 65 and 94% since the State of Alarm was decreed. Referring to the difficulties of carriers to see their minimum needs covered in the journeys due to the closure of service stations and restaurants, Miranda has concluded that it is mandatory that “establishments that supply fuel or loading and unloading centers provide toilets and, if available, catering services “for these professionals. Official workshops have also been set up to repair freight vehicles.
